如果是企业要做APP的话,如果你要做的是模板APP,后期功能开发会让你很难实现好。委以重任的APP就不要用模板开发了。定制APP开发未来运营才有可能有出路,这要看你开发的APP是原生的还是混合的,也要看你的运营是否做的好。那么,企业主迷茫了,原生APP和混合APP究竟是什么?
一、什么是原生开发APP?混合开发APP?
原生开发APP:即Native App,一般指用原生开发语言开发APP,原生开发语言就是单纯的指开发整个系统时所使用的编程语言。该开发针对IOS、Android、Windows等不同的手机操作系统要采用不同的语言和框架进行开发,且APP应用所包含的所有UI元素、数据、逻辑框架都安装在手机终端上。
混合开发的APP:即Hybrid App,指的是在一个APP中内嵌一个轻量级的浏览器,也就是嵌入网页页面,一部分原生的功能改为H5页面来开发,修改的这部分功能不只能够在不升级APP的情况下更新,且能够在安卓或者iOS的APP上都可同时运行,用户体验更好又节省开发资源。
了解原生/混合开发APP后,APP开发应该选择原生开发还是混合APP开发呢?郑州APP开发公司从技术层面以及多年的开发经验上来说,混合开发APP在后期的使用上可能还需要重新构建,相比较之下,原生更适合长久发展。
二、原生APP开发/混合APP开发优缺点?
1、原生开发APP的优缺点
优点:原生开发APP的安装包较小、性能高、运行速度也是很快的,最应关注的一个点是,使用原生开发APP不会出现因为用户浏览量暴增而导致死机的状况出现。这个只需要技术员做一下数据库的主从分离、读写分离以及数据库的负载均衡就很容易的解决这个问题。
缺点:这个需要从企业的APP开发项目预算成本上讲,原生APP开发需要的技术员比较多,至少需要一个安卓和一和iOS开发工程师,以及其他必须的项目执行、策划、UI等。所以开发成本相对来说会高一些,开发的周期也会较长。
2、混合开发APP的优缺点
优点:这个需要从我们所开发APP的类型来考虑,比如说是新闻资讯类APP或者是电商类APP开发,我们可以选择混合APP开发,可兼容多个平台,更新速度也快,节约跨平台的资本投入。
缺点:混合开发APP的安装包比较大,打开安装包运行的时间较长,而且运行的时间越长,手机出现卡顿的几率也会越大。
选择哪种开发方式比较合理,还是要依据APP项目的需要,小编建议,不管哪种开发模式都会有一定的利弊存在,关键还是选择对企业APP需要的、有助于长久经营的有利方式。
郑州知网计算机软件有限公司拥有雄厚的技术研发实力,致力于为客户提供完美的原生APP开发解决方案。把握市场动向,深耕O2O领域。您的电商大业,由知网软件守护